    The dealership looks up vehicles by VIN number and tells you the part numbers that the database tells them, they don't know any better that you can mix parts across the submodels. Just FYI everything across all submodels are interchangeable, except when it comes to electronics and premium tech options. But for the most part anything thats on the PRO will fit on your Sport.
